Safety and Material Quality

Choosing a safe and high-quality building block set starts with verifying the materials used. I always look for sets made from non-toxic, BPA-free, and food-grade materials to guarantee my child’s safety. Smooth, rounded edges and surfaces are essential to prevent cuts or injuries during play. I also check that the materials are durable and resistant to breaking or chipping, which ensures the set will last through rough handling. It’s important to confirm that the plastic or wood complies with safety standards like CPC, ASTM, or EN71 certifications. Additionally, I prefer blocks free from small parts or sharp points, reducing choking hazards and making playtime safer. These precautions help make certain that my toddler can explore and create confidently without safety concerns.

Age-Appropriate Design

Selecting the right building block set for toddlers involves paying close attention to design features that match their developmental stage. Blocks should be appropriately sized to prevent choking hazards, with large, toddler-safe pieces for ages 1-3. The shapes and features need to encourage skill progression, from simple stacking to more complex structures as they grow. Materials should be non-toxic and free of sharp edges, ensuring safety during hands-on exploration. Easy-to-handle pieces with grips and textures tailored to motor skills make building accessible and fun. Additionally, the color schemes and visual details should be engaging but not overstimulating, supporting cognitive and sensory development. Overall, choosing age-appropriate designs helps foster confidence and creativity while prioritizing safety.

Durability and Construction

Durability and construction are essential factors to take into account because toddlers tend to play vigorously, often roughing up their toys. High-quality building blocks are made from sturdy materials like solid wood, BPA-free plastic, or reinforced cardboard, making sure they can handle rough handling without breaking. Well-constructed blocks feature smooth, rounded edges and secure joints, which prevent chipping, cracking, or splintering during play. Choosing fragile or thin materials increases the risk of breakage, shortening the set’s lifespan and creating safety hazards. Heavyweight, sturdy blocks stay stable during stacking, reducing accidental toppling. Proper design also makes certain pieces connect seamlessly, allowing for more complex creations and extending the building possibilities. Overall, durable construction guarantees safety, longevity, and a more enjoyable play experience for your toddler.

Are There Safety Certifications for These Building Block Sets?

Yes, many premium building block sets for toddlers come with safety certifications like ASTM F963, EN71, or CPSIA compliance. I always check for these labels before purchasing, as they guarantee the toys meet strict safety standards. It’s important to verify these certifications to keep your little one safe while they explore and create. Always read product descriptions carefully to confirm the sets are certified and suitable for toddlers.
